This morning I had roughly 90 minutes to do a hard set of intervals (3x2'; 3x1'; 3x30"). Since the actual work time was so short and the efforts so hard, I needed a decent warm up. I spun very easily for the first 10 minutes, then gradually increased till I started to break a sweat (another 10 min or so). Did the intervals and then cool down was essentially a reverse of the warm up.
Rule of thumb: the shorter the event/workout, the longer the warmup.
